RSL Choir Concert - by Allira, Seha & Vayarn
On Wednesday the 23rd of April, the Choir had an amazing visit with the residents at Vasey RSL. First we were welcomed by Anchal, and then we went inside and got ready to perform our three songs. After Ms. Lisa introduced us, we sang 'One Day', 'Spirit of the ANZACs', and 'Everything'. Everyone really enjoyed our concert!
After our singing, we did some word searches and ANZAC colouring sheets. We sat with the residents and did them together. We learned some really interesting things about the residents and their experiences. We had so much fun chatting with them.
We were very blessed to meet a World War II veteran named John, who was 102 years old! He could remember so much about the war, and he loved sharing his story, so we got to ask him lots of questions.
